Original Description
Jan Weenix's Stilleben Med Doda Faglar (Still Life with Dead Birds) is a masterful 17th-century Dutch still life that captures the Baroque era's fascination with life, death, and opulence. The painting depicts an elaborate arrangement of hunted game—luxuriantly feathered birds draped over a stone ledge, their vibrant plumage contrasting with the cool, muted background. Weenix's hyper-realistic technique, with meticulous attention to texture and light, infuses the scene with both grandeur and melancholy. As a leading still-life painter of the late Golden Age, Weenix elevated game still lifes into aristocratic trophies, symbolizing wealth and the transience of life. This work exemplifies the Dutch pronkstilleven (ostentatious still life) tradition, blending morbid symbolism with exquisite craftsmanship, and remains a significant bridge between Dutch realism and later decorative European art.
